If this material is a Cyanoacrylate (crazy glue or CA) or another material that activates with air or moisture, or reacts to metal, then you will need a dispenser that will handle the properties peculiar to it.


To dispense a very thin material properly, you now need to decide whether you want to use a syringe based dispenser or whether you should use a dispense valve with a controller and a pressure pot. Here are some things to consider:

Syringe dispensing of Cyanoacrylates:

In some cases, an inexpensive syringe based dispenser is used to dispense a CA or very thin material with exceptional grabbing power. The syringe is loaded and kept upright and the material is dispensed WITHOUT using a piston in the syringe barrel. The reason for this, of course, is that the glue will grab your piston and glue it to the wall, or build up a ridge on the interior of the syringe that will break the air tight seal necessary for it to work properly. The dispense tip in this case should be a Teflon tip.

Valve dispensing of Cyanoacrylates:

Consider our two mainstays in the dispensing of CA; the Diaphragm Valve and the Pinch Tube Valve. Both can be safely used with CA materials and safe pressure chambers.

Other thin materials:

If the material is just thin, but not a CA, the valves mentioned above will work and the pressure pots will be good too. Also, the other IDS valves and syringe dispensers with a tight seal such as our front closing valve should work fine. Dispense through any of our IntelliSpense dispense tips.
